Prison Sentences for Two Individuals for Illegal Drug Possession

The Paphos District Court sentenced a 35-year-old to 3.5 years in prison and a 19-year-old to 2.5 years, after finding them guilty of illegal possession of drugs with intent to supply to others. The two men were arrested by YKAN (Cyprus Drug Squad) on September 24, 2025, during a coordinated operation in Paphos. During the search, 62 grams of cannabis, 15 grams of cocaine, metal grinders, and a precision scale were found in their possession. The drugs were intended for trafficking and sale to third parties. The court took into consideration the quantities of drugs, the tools found in their possession, and the fact that illegal drug possession is a serious offense. The conviction aims to deter similar crimes and protect society. The case was investigated by the Paphos YKAN, which continues to conduct checks to combat drug addiction and trafficking in the area.
